About this campsite
Borumba Dam Campground, set in an open, flat site, is an ideal camping location with easy access for both large and smaller camping vehicles. Located just off a sealed, albeit narrow road from Imbil, the campground is conveniently situated near Borumba Dam, famed for its fishing and boating activities. Visitors can indulge in swimming, paddling or rent small boats available at the park office if they're without their own equipment. A nearby boat ramp provides easy access to the dam, although it's important to adhere to the no-boating and no-fishing zones between the boat ramp and the dam wall.

Charlie Moreland Campground
Charlie Moreland Campground, located in the tranquil setting of Imbil State Forest, provides an idyllic environment for camping enthusiasts. Accessible by two-wheel drive vehicles, it boasts an open forest setting for campers, rather than defined sites. Camping permits are required, ensuring a safe and regulated environment. It's a perfect getaway for those seeking a blend of nature and adventure.
